Casper and the Cookies thrice coming to Iowa

Submitted by Andrew Roger on August 4, 2009 – 12:27 pmNo Comment

biggray_cookiesvansmYou may have seen Casper and the Cookies on tour with Apples in Stereo or The Poison Control Center, or got to hear the their tremendous release, Optimist’s Club. But now after a full year of recording with the likes of Bill Doss of Olivia Tremor Control, Robert Schneider of Apples in Stereo, and Vanessa Briscoe Hay of Pylon, they are releasing a killer followup album Modern Silence. Check out Little King for their take on bubblegum pop, shoegazing, and rocknroll. With all that, they are touring and playing three Iowa shows for you, 8/6 in Des Moines at the Vaudeville Mews, 8/8 at Ames Progressive, and 8/11 in Iowa City at the Mill. They must love Iowa. So any of you out there can see these guys. Definitely come check them out.

Vinyl nerds “People in a Place to Know” are releasing the vinyl version, a special 2xLP plus a killer 5″ lathe cut with extras songs and mixes. It’s a solid $20 but more than worth it.
